James F. Brown, 90, of Tipp City, OH, formerly of Kittanning, PA., passed away Wednesday at the Upper Valley Hospital in Troy, OH.
James was born April 24, 1929 in Kittanning, PA. He was the son of the late Theodore W. Brown and Bertha A. (Salsgiver) Brown.
James served 13 ½ years in the military and worked for Acutus (formerly Oilwell Supply) in Oil City, PA.
He attended the Tipp City Church of the Nazarene in Tipp City, OH.
James is survived by his wife Evelyn Moon Brown, whom he married December 28, 1962; one daughter, Kirsten Brown Deskins and her husband Wesley of Austin, TX; and two grandchildren Jacob Deskins and his wife Jennifer, of Kettering OH, and Madison Deskins Bloom and her husband Will, of Milwaukee, WI.
Also surviving are five sisters, Ruth Guidi of Las Vegas, NV, Emogene Houser of Kittanning, PA, Pauline Otterson of Butler, PA, Judy Stitt of Kittanning, PA, and Sally Metzger of Turnersville, NJ.
James was preceded in death by three brothers; Randolph Brown, Theodore Brown Jr. and Gary Brown and three sisters; Margaret Lions, Orvetta Brown and Karen McQuisten.
